How they compare
Kenya currently reports 5.12 units per US$ of GDP against 4.22 units per US$ of GDP in Nepal, a difference of 0.9 units per US$ of GDP.
That makes Kenya's figure about 1.2 times Nepal's.
The two have swapped places 9 times across 43 shared years of data; in 1966 it was Nepal ahead.
Kenya ranks 61st and Nepal ranks 62nd of 151 countries.
Across the 5 decades both report, Kenya averaged higher in 1 and Nepal in 4.

About this data
Capital Accounts (Depository Corporations Survey, Domestic currency) divided by GDP (current US$),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
